Roof Replacement Cost in Terrell, Texas: What Homeowners Need to Know

Typical installed range — full replacement
$6,000 – $25,000

A full roof replacement in Terrell typically runs $6,000 – $25,000 installed — $450 – $1,100 per square (100 sq ft) — including tear-off, permits, and local labor.

Roofing cost by material.

Installed price ranges for a full roof replacement in Terrell, adjusted for local labor and code. Linked materials have a dedicated city guide.

  • Architectural shingle roof
    Dimensional laminated shingles — the U.S. default
    $8,000 – $16,000
  • 3-tab shingle roof
    Entry-level asphalt
    $6,000 – $10,500
  • Standing-seam metal roof
    Concealed fasteners, 40–70 year service life
    $15,000 – $40,000
  • Corrugated metal roof
    Exposed-fastener panels
    $8,000 – $20,000
  • Flat roof membrane
    TPO, EPDM, or PVC for low-slope sections
    $5,000 – $15,000
  • Tear-off & disposal
    Removing the old roof, dumpster included
    $1,000 – $3,000
  • Permits & inspection
    Varies by municipality
    $250 – $1,000

* Ranges adjusted for Terrell's tier and median income — verify with an on-site quote.

Before you sign: the quote checklist

  •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Terrell.
  •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
  •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
  •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Cost factors

Why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Terrell

Several local factors affect roof replacement costs in Terrell. The climate brings intense summer UV exposure that can degrade asphalt shingles faster than in cooler regions. Hailstorms, while not annual, can cause widespread damage that drives up demand and material prices. Terrell's housing stock includes older homes with steep slopes or complex rooflines that require more labor. Texas state building codes mandate specific underlayment and fastening standards, which can add to material costs. Local labor rates and disposal fees for old roofing materials also vary by contractor and season.

Field notes

Common Roof Issues Leading to Replacement in Terrell

  1. Hail Damage

    Hailstorms in North Texas can bruise asphalt shingles, causing granule loss and exposing the mat. Over time, this leads to leaks and accelerated aging, often requiring full replacement.

  2. Wind Uplift

    Strong winds from spring storms can lift shingles, breaking seals and causing curling or tearing. Repeated wind events weaken the roof's integrity, making replacement necessary.

  3. UV Degradation

    Intense Texas sun breaks down asphalt shingles over time, causing them to become brittle, crack, and lose granules. This is especially common on south-facing slopes in older Terrell neighborhoods.

  4. Age and Wear

    Many homes in Terrell's established areas have roofs nearing or past their 20-25 year lifespan. As shingles age, they lose flexibility and become prone to leaks, prompting replacement.

  5. Improper Installation

    Some older homes in Terrell have roofs installed before modern building codes. Flashing, underlayment, or ventilation issues can lead to premature failure, making a full replacement the right solution.

The process

What to Expect During a Roof Replacement in Terrell

In Texas, roofing contractors must hold a state license from the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) for work over $3,000. Your local building department in Terrell will require a permit for roof replacement. The process typically starts with an inspection and measurement, followed by tear-off of old materials, underlayment installation, flashing replacement, and new shingle installation. A final inspection ensures compliance with the state building code. Work usually takes one to three days depending on roof size and complexity.

Q&A

Roof Replacement cost questions — Terrell

What factors affect roof replacement cost in Terrell?

Cost depends on roof size, slope, material type (e.g., asphalt shingles vs. metal), and local labor rates. Hail damage claims can also influence material availability and pricing. Permits and disposal fees add to the total. Getting multiple quotes helps you understand the range.

How do I choose a roofing contractor in Terrell?

Look for a contractor with a valid Texas TDLR license, general liability insurance, and worker's compensation. Check references and online reviews. Ask about their experience with local building codes and whether they handle permits. Avoid contractors who require full payment upfront.

Does Texas require a license for roofers?

Yes, Texas requires roofing contractors to be licensed by the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) for projects over $3,000. Always verify a contractor's license before hiring. The state also requires a permit from your local building department for roof replacements.

When is the ideal time for roof replacement in Terrell?

Spring and fall offer mild temperatures, making work easier on materials and crews. Summer heat can slow down installation, while winter cold may affect shingle sealing. However, scheduling after a hailstorm may mean longer wait times due to high demand.

Do I need a permit for roof replacement in Terrell?

Yes, the city of Terrell requires a building permit for roof replacement. Your contractor should handle the permit application. The permit ensures the work meets the state building code and includes a final inspection to verify proper installation.
